Stellar's Strategic Move
Stellar, a blockchain network with a unique structure, has taken a proactive approach. Its three-stage migration plan is a bold strategy to transition to quantum-safe cryptography. The beauty of Stellar's design is its separation of account identity from signing keys, allowing users to upgrade to quantum-safe cryptography without disrupting their addresses or balances. This is a significant advantage over other blockchains, where such a transition could be far more chaotic.
The Migration Timeline
The proposed roadmap is a well-thought-out process. By 2026, enterprise wallets can start migrating, and by the end of 2027, all accounts will have the option to upgrade. This gradual approach is crucial, as it allows the community to adapt without panic. However, one intriguing challenge remains: dormant accounts. What happens to accounts whose holders are no longer reachable? This ethical dilemma demands a community-driven solution, highlighting the democratic nature of blockchain technology.
